Output 28e63b40a3752325d30344f33defb92d907010961255cd4708404e2dfc2552b0:0

value
2655000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edb57616a7d8e916627f8de46c775b3314143d84 OP_EQUALVERIFY OP_CHECKSIG
address
1NftXcfCCpUSgkSu4W24di8W1UnuFzLq3Y
transaction
28e63b40a3752325d30344f33defb92d907010961255cd4708404e2dfc2552b0
spent
true